Aert Mitts

Sale price$7.00

These colorwork mitts are worked bottom up with thumb gusset shaping. Once the thumb shaping is finished those stitches are put on hold and the remainder of the hand is worked in the round.

• Additional length can be added to the thumb and hand area by working more plain rows or working additional ribbing rows.

• Of course, it is entirely possible to use less shades than the 7 used here. Two tone versions would look lovely too!

• Two sizes have been provided. 

Sizing

1 (2) Adult S/M (M/L)
Hand Circumference: 7 (8)” / 18 (20.5)
Length from cuff to top: 8” / 20.5 cm both versions

Materials

Yarn
Fingering weight yarn in the following amounts:
Note: Other than the MC, there isn’t a significant difference in yardage between the two sizes. Therefore, the same yardage is provided for both sizes for the contrast shades.

MC: 80 (90) yds / 73 (82) m
CC1: 20 yds / 18 m
CC2: 30 yds / 27.5 m
CC3: 20 yds / 18 m
CC4: 15 yds / 14 m
CC5: 15 yds / 14 m

Shown in Jamieson’s of Shetland Spindrift (100% Shetland Wool; 105m / 115yds per 25g ball)

Size 1- Wren (MC), Cinnamon (CC1), Sand (CC2), Bluebell (CC3) Flax, (CC4) Mint (CC5), Willow (CC6)
Size 2- Earth (MC), Mint (CC1), Eesit (CC2), Moss (CC3), Oyster (CC4), Spagnum (CC5), Salmon (CC6),

Needles
US 1 / 2.5mm long circular needle to work magic loop or DPNS
US 2 / 3mm long circular needle to work magic loop or DPNS
US 3 / 3.25 mm long circular needle to work magic loop or DPNS

Always use a needle size that will result in the correct gauge after blocking.

Notions 2 stitch markers, tapestry needle for weaving in ends, scrap yarn to hold sts.

Gauge

34 sts & 34 rounds = 4” / 10cm over Fair Isle Pattern on US 3 / 3.25mm needles after blocking
35 sts & 44 rounds = 4” / 10cm in Rib Pattern on US 1 / 2.5 mm needles after blocking
